Lahore: Renowned versatile television and film actor Saleem Nasir on his 33rd death anniversary.
Saleem Nasir was born on November 15, 1944 in Nagpur, British India.
He started his professional career with the film 'Zaib-un-Nisa` in 1976.
His famous plays are Aakhri Chatan, Nishan-e-Haider, Ankahi, Dastak and Aangan Terha.
Sultan Jalal ud Din in the serial Aakhree Chataan and Captain Sarwar Shaheed in the drama series Nishan e Haider were his famous roles.
He was awarded the President's Pride of Performance Award' posthumously.
He died on this day in 1989 in Karachi.
